Memory blanket for Molly (it would be pretentious to call it a quilt!) The squares are cut from my sister's T-shirts. Mave (Songthrush) loved bags, shoes and tigers so those designs feature strongly. 13 year old Molly (her grand-daughter) has Asberger's and loves dolphins. The central dolphin was a test stitchout we found amongst Mave's fabric. The patchwork is mounted on polar fleece and simply tied at each intersection.

What size did you make your squares?

18cm. I hooped old sheeting and used an 18cm outline to stitch the jersey fabric to it before stitching the design. The outline was then my stitching line for joining the squares.
